Dr. Pinnamaneni is an MBBS from Lady Hardinge Medical College, India and a MPH from Harvard T.H. Chan School of Public Health. Dr. Pinnamaneni has been developing case studies that study Anemia interventions targeting adolescent girls and young women in LMICs and developing curriculum for the training of health journalists in India. She is also working with Green Screen – a passive cooling panel designed to bring down indoor room temperatures in urban slums, decrease the incidence of heat strokes and improve quality of life. Dr. Pinnamaneni’s research interests lie within child health, infectious diseases and community behaviour change. Her desire to learn more about health communication and bring about a change in community behaviours in MCH brought her to the Lab.
